剪切对低浓度聚合物冻胶成胶行为的影响

摘    要:低浓度聚合物冻胶体系在现场的注入和地下的渗流过程中会遇到剪切问题,因此,研究各种剪切因素对低浓度聚合物冻胶成胶行为的影响具有实际意义。用实验方法研究了剪切速率和剪切时间对2种成胶体系的低浓度聚合物冻胶成胶行为的影响。实验结果表明,动态成胶与静态成胶相比,其成胶速度和所成冻胶的强度都大不相同。剪切速率对成胶有极大影响。在一定的剪切速率下,成胶有提前发生的趋向。随着剪切速率的增大,所成冻胶的强度降低;剪切速率愈大,发生冻胶强度下降的时间愈早。剪切时间对成胶也有极大影响,随着剪切时间的增加,冻胶的强度逐渐降低。图5表1参1(郭海莉摘

The effect of shear rate and shear time on jelling behavior of weak gel formed with solution of low polymer concentration.

Abstract:During its well site injection and flowing in reservoir, weak gel formed with solution of low polymer concentration could meet shear problem. So, it has practical significance to study the effect of shear on gelling behavior of weak gel formed with the solution of low polymer concentration. The effects of shear rate and shear time on gelling behavior of weak gel formed with the solution of low polymer concentration are studied in this paper. Some results were gained. The experimental results showed that comparing dynamic gelling behavior with static gelling behavior, rate of gelling and strength of gel are greatly different. Shear rate has great influence upon gelling behavior, cross liking was advanced at certain rate. Strength of gel was decreased with the increase of shear rate. The higher shear rate, the earlier reduction of strength of gel. Shear time has great influence upon gelling behavior either. Strength of gel was decreased with the increase of shear time.
